Just got 04 last week and immediately my 11 year old has the back plate off his robosapien and is clipping off the 4 mhz oscillator. That part was easy.We tore up an old radio and just happened to find a capacitor that is 10V and 22uF. It's the light blue cylinder type. We attached it with alligator clips, but no luck, the robo won't power up. So I tried about a dozen other capacitors, cylinders, buttons, beads, none work. Some say "103P" does that mean 103 pico Farads? Is there a web sight to tell me how to tell the uF of a capacitor?
Failing that, in what sort of electonic junk am I likely to find a 6 mhz crystal oscillator? A toaster? A radio?
